Volleyball drops heartbreaker at Smith 3-2

Northampton, MA- The MCLA Trailblazers Volleyball program lost a five set heart breaker at Smith College tonight falling to the Pioneers 3-2.  Smith improves its mark to 4-2 while MCLA drops to 2-3 overall.

The Pioneers took the opening set 25-14 before the Trailblazers rallied and took the second 25-18.  Smith would win the pivotal third set at 25-22, however MCLA stayed alive winning the fourth 25-19.  Smith would close out MCLA 15-9 in the deciding fifth set.

MCLA got strong performances from Brianne O'Rourke and Samantha Anderson.  O'Rourke tallied 14 kills on 34 attacks, while Anderson chipped in with 12 kills and hit .357 for the match.  Allie Chang had a season high 30 digs for MCLA, while Jackie Paluilis and Angelica Perfido each ended the night with 17.  Courtney Parent set up the middle hitters all night racking up 31 assists.

Smith was led by Mei-Li Smith's 16 kills and 28 digs.  Allison Hardy added 10 kills and 17 digs, while Dayra Diaz Marquez had 9 kills and 17 digs.  Marquez added 24 assists and 17 digs on the night.  

MCLA is back in action on Saturday when they travel to Becker College.
